(CommandList children: [ (FuncDef name: check body: (BraceGroup children: [ (If arms: [ (if_arm cond: [ (Pipeline children: [ (C {(grep)} {(-q)} {(DQ ($ VSub_Number '$2'))} {(DQ ($ VSub_Number '$1'))}) ] negated: T ) ] action: [ (C {(echo)} {(DQ ('Did not find expected section in ') ($ VSub_Number '$1') (':'))}) (C {(echo)} {(DQ (' ') ($ VSub_Number '$2'))}) (C {(echo)} {(DQ )}) (C {(echo)} {(DQ ('Actual output below:'))}) (C {(cat)} {(DQ ($ VSub_Number '$1'))}) (ControlFlow token:<ControlFlow_Exit exit> arg_word:{(1)}) ] spids: [16777215 92] ) ] spids: [16777215 137] ) ] spids: [72] ) spids: [68 71] ) (C {(check)} {(script_test_8.stdout)} { (DQ (EscapedLiteralPart token:<Lit_EscapedChar '\\\\'>) ('.interp[ \t]*PROGBITS[ \t]*0*20001000') ) } ) (C {(check)} {(script_test_8.stdout)} { (DQ (EscapedLiteralPart token:<Lit_EscapedChar '\\\\'>) ('.data[ \t]*PROGBITS[ \t]*0*20200000') ) } ) (C {(check)} {(script_test_8.stdout)} {(DQ (EscapedLiteralPart token:<Lit_EscapedChar '\\\\'>) ('.bss[ \t]*NOBITS[ \t]*0*2040....'))} ) ] )